Why You Should Test a Sauna Before Buying One

A sauna isn’t something you want to guess about. Every sauna model feels different depending on materials, heater style, steam levels, and temperature range. Testing a sauna gives you clarity on important questions like:

• Do you prefer wood-fired heat or electric?
• Do you like higher temperatures or softer steam?
• Does the sauna size fit the number of people you’ll typically host?
• Does the atmosphere match the mood you want—relaxation, recovery, or social?
• How does the sauna feel in your backyard, driveway, or cabin setting?

Experiencing the environment firsthand helps you make a confident decision instead of relying on showroom samples or online descriptions.
